What is a Cleanser?

A cleanser is a skincare product specifically formulated to remove dirt, oil, makeup, and impurities from the skin. Unlike face washes, cleansers are generally gentler and often contain moisturizing and soothing ingredients. Cleansers come in various forms, including creams, lotions, gels, and oils, catering to different skin types and concerns.

Types of Cleansers

  • Cream Cleansers: These are thick and creamy, making them perfect for dry or sensitive skin.
  • Gel Cleansers: Typically lightweight and often infused with ingredients like salicylic acid, gel cleansers are ideal for oily or acne-prone skin.
  • Oil Cleansers: These cleansers dissolve excess oil and makeup without stripping the skin of its natural moisture, making them suitable for all skin types, especially dry and sensitive skin.
  • Foam Cleansers: Creating a rich lather, foam cleansers are great for combination or oily skin as they help control excess oil.

What is a Face Wash?

A face wash is a more specific type of cleanser with a foaming formula designed to deeply cleanse the skin. Face washes are typically used to remove excess oil, sweat, and dirt from the skin’s surface. They often contain ingredients that target specific skin concerns, such as acne or excess oil.

Types of Face Washes

  • Foaming Face Wash: These create a bubbly lather and are excellent for oily or acne-prone skin as they deeply cleanse the pores.
  • Non-Foaming Face Wash: These are milder and don’t produce a lather, making them suitable for dry or sensitive skin.
  • Exfoliating Face Wash: Containing small particles or acids, these face washes help remove dead skin cells and promote a smoother complexion.

Key Differences Between Cleansers and Face Washes

Understanding the key differences between cleansers and face washes can help you choose the right product for your skincare needs.

Purpose and Function

  • Cleansers: Designed to gently remove impurities, makeup, and excess oil without disrupting the skin’s natural moisture barrier. They are suitable for daily use, especially for those with dry or sensitive skin.
  • Face Washes: Formulated to provide a deeper cleanse, face washes are more effective at removing dirt, sweat, and oil from the skin’s surface. They are particularly beneficial for oily or acne-prone skin.

Formulation and Texture

  • Cleansers: Available in various textures, including creams, gels, oils, and lotions, cleansers are often infused with moisturizing and soothing ingredients.
  • Face Washes: Typically come in gel or foam forms and focus on deep cleansing the skin.

Skin Type Compatibility

  • Cleansers: Suitable for all skin types, with specific formulations available for dry, sensitive, oily, and combination skin.
  • Face Washes: Generally better for oily, combination, or acne-prone skin due to their deeper cleansing properties.

How to Choose Between a Cleanser and a Face Wash

Choosing between a cleanser and a face wash depends on your skin type, concerns, and preferences.

For Dry or Sensitive Skin

If you have dry or sensitive skin, a gentle cream or oil cleanser is ideal. These products will effectively remove impurities without stripping your skin of essential moisture.

For Oily or Acne-Prone Skin

For those with oily or acne-prone skin, a foaming face wash or a gel cleanser with ingredients like salicylic acid can help control excess oil and prevent breakouts.

The Importance of Daily Cleansing

Daily cleansing is an essential step in any skincare routine, as it helps to remove impurities, excess oil, and makeup that can clog pores and lead to breakouts. Whether you choose a cleanser or a face wash, consistency is key to maintaining healthy skin.

Morning Routine

In the morning, a gentle cleanser can help remove any buildup of oil or impurities accumulated overnight. This prepares your skin for the application of other skincare products, such as serums and moisturizers.

Evening Routine

At night, a more thorough cleanse is necessary to remove the day’s makeup, dirt, and pollution. This is where a face wash can be particularly beneficial, providing a deeper cleanse to ensure your skin is completely clean before applying nighttime skincare products.
